Union Cabinet Approves Proposal To Promulgate Triple Talaq Ordinance
In view of the lapse of the contentious Triple Talaq Bill, the Union Cabinet has approved the proposal to promulgate an Ordinance on the subject.The ordinance to be titled The Muslim Women (Protection of Rights on Marriage) Second Ordinance 2019 seeks to "protect the rights of married Muslim women and prevent divorce by the practise of instantaneous and irrevocable 'talaq-e-biddat' by the...
Angel Tax Norms Relaxed By Centre In Relief To Start-Ups [Read Notification]
In a major relief to several start-ups, the Central Government has widened the definition of start-ups which are entitled to exemption from 'angel tax'.'Angel Tax' is the market term used for income tax charged under the head "income from other sources" as per Section 56(viib) of the Income Tax Act,1961 on capital raised by unlisted companies by issue of shares at a price in excess of their...
